Overview

Postcode WS4 2DE is located in a major urban area, within the St Matthew's ward of Walsall in the West Midlands region, and forms part of the Walsall North East area. It has very low deprivation and average crime levels, with around 46.6 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 52% below the West Midlands average of 97 per 1,000. The average income per household in Walsall North East is £48,913 per year. The nearest station is Walsall, about 1.2 miles away. There are 2 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area.
